About This Book

Captain Gringo dodges death in revolution-torn Mazatlán! First he gets double-crossed by a beautiful black-hearted blonde. Then he's cold-cocked by an American officer obsessed with bringing "The Renegade" to the U.S. for hanging. If that isn't enough, he's got himself trapped in the middle of a bloody revolution—and either side would be happy to separate his head from his shoulders. But Captain Gringo's greatest threat won't come in the heat of battle—it'll come in the heat of blood-boiling lust from a supple and sensuous senorita who knows the way to a man's heart is definitely not through his stomach.
